Are There Any Replacement Cradles To Fit A 2 Diameter Bar For A Step Through E-Bike  

Question:

The Curt 18030 cradles are too big to put through my new bike frame. I don’t want to buy a new rack. It’s a step through ebike weighing just under 50 lbs. A cross bar adaptor would not be safe for the weight of the bike.

0

Expert Reply:

For your situation, you would need to purchase a new bike rack as we do not sell cradles that are 2" in diameter as described.

So, to carry your e-bikes weighing in just under 50lbs, I recommend the Thule T2 Pro XTR Bike Rack for 4 Bikes - 2" Hitches - Wheel Mount # TH69TX. This has a maximum weight capacity of 160lbs, and a single bike weight capacity of 60lbs.

To safely carry your step through style e-bike; you'll need an adapter like the Swagman Bike Frame Adapter Bar for Electric, Step Through, and Cruiser Bikes # S57FR.

Also, to note, even if we did have the cradles, the Curt 4 bike rack you have the Curt 4 Bike Rack for 1-1/4" and 2" Hitches # C18030 is only rated for 45lbs a bike, which would not be enough to safely carry your bikes.
